Been a few badies going around lately hey....

Had one a while ago (think it was called windows anti virus xp). Downloaeded this thing, then got this cleverly disguised windows type pop-up (with the windows logo ie almost identical to the firewall one (actual windows program pop-up)) "your computer is at risk, dl this... blah blah blah..."

After that, good bye computer:silly: had to get a guy to fix it, wouldn't let me do a thing. No internet, no system restore, no add/remove hardware.... URGH!!!
